Time Zero Performance
In the thermal interface industry, the focus is often on Time Zero Performance, the initial efficiency of a material in lowering chip temperatures. But focusing here only reveals part of the story. 

Waste & Disposal
Expired thermal paste and scrapped components add to waste and disposal costs. Data centers generate 2+ million tons of e-waste annually.

Maintenance & Storage
Frequent replacements and inspections drain time and resources. Storing the accessories, tools and cleaning supplies also incurs extra costs.

Rework & Assembly
Messy application and inconsistent performance increase rework and delays, costing up to $200 per heat sink.

Downtime & Failure
Unreliable thermal paste leads to overheating, causing unexpected shutdowns and costly failures. The average downtime for a data center costs over $1 million.
